equal_range — returns both bounds. lower_bound — returns only lower bound.
1std::vector<int> v = {1, 2, 2, 2, 3, 4};23// lower_bound — just first >= value4auto lb = std::lower_bound(v.begin(), v.end(), 2);56// equal_range — both bounds7auto range = std::equal_range(v.begin(), v.end(), 2);8auto lb = range.first; // Same as lower_bound9auto ub = range.second; // Same as upper_bound1011// Count12int count = std::distance(range.first, range.second);13// 3
